Auto merge of #85041 - mibac138:suggest-generics, r=estebank
Suggest adding a type parameter for impls

Add a new suggestion upon encountering an unknown type in a `impl` that suggests adding a new type parameter. This diagnostic suggests to add a new type parameter even though it may be a const parameter, however after adding the parameter and running rustc again a follow up error steers the user to change the type parameter to a const parameter.

```rust
struct X<const C: ()>();
impl X<C> {}
```
suggests
```
error[E0412]: cannot find type `C` in this scope
 --> bar.rs:2:8
  |
1 | struct X<const C: ()>();
  | ------------------------ similarly named struct `X` defined here
2 | impl X<C> {}
  |        ^
  |
help: a struct with a similar name exists
  |
2 | impl X<X> {}
  |        ^
help: you might be missing a type parameter
  |
2 | impl<C> X<C> {}
  |     ^^^
```
After adding a type parameter the code now becomes
```rust
struct X<const C: ()>();
impl<C> X<C> {}
```
and the error now fully steers the user towards the correct code
```
error[E0747]: type provided when a constant was expected
 --> bar.rs:2:11
  |
2 | impl<C> X<C> {}
  |           ^
  |
help: consider changing this type parameter to be a `const` generic
  |
2 | impl<const C: ()> X<C> {}
  |      ^^^^^^^^^^^
```
